Output 6de3a812a23192bdd7515b7d137756a868a241d51388d4149005de000ddd6ab6:3

value
18625204
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c729d9fdba26ebf129edf6ac782de2617bd1b2e OP_EQUALVERIFY OP_CHECKSIG
address
1M6cxqsPKYqaJAxtwngVN1jxTvexfDmYcG
transaction
6de3a812a23192bdd7515b7d137756a868a241d51388d4149005de000ddd6ab6
confirmations
456897
spent
true